Title: Classification and uses of finger prints.
Description: London, George Routledge, 1900, gr. in-8°, IV + 112 p. illustrated + 8 pl. + 3 folding pl., original cloth-binding. Fine clean copy. ¶ First edition ot this renowned work, with over 200 diagrams to illustrate the letterpress. "E.R. Henry had reported to the Commission his own use of the system as Inspector-General of Police in Bengal, and in 1900 he published 'Classification and uses of Finger Prints', on which the system now used throughout the world is based. Henry was a Police Commissioner at Scotland Yard from 1903 to 1918." (Printing and the Mind of Man, no. 376).
